    • @BrixFitness
      @BrixFitness  Před 5 měsíci

      I've coached many busy people, and the trick is always to find ways to be active without needing extra time. For example, you can take 5 to 10 minutes to move around every 2 to 3 hours during your day, like walking around your office. Starting with every two hours is a good way to slowly add activity. Short workouts of 10 or 15 minutes can be effective. You can wake up 30 minutes earlier to fit in a 15-minute workout-it's possible if you make it a priority. Once you realize how much better your life can be when you prioritize your health, you'll find a way to do it. There are lots of strategies online to help you fit movement and healthy eating into your day without needing extra time. Just do some research and focus on understanding how important it is for you to be as healthy as possible.
